- NAVIGATION DATA
The computer systems and software procedures used to operate this website acquire, during their normal operation, some personal data whose transmission is implicit in the use of Internet communication protocols. This is information that is not collected to be associated with identified interested parties, but which by their very nature could, through processing and association with data held by third parties, allow users to be identified. This category of data includes the IP addresses or domain names of the computers used by users who connect to the site, the URI (Uniform Resource Identifier) addresses of the requested resources, the time of the request, the method used to submit the request to the server, the size of the file obtained in response, the numerical code indicating the status of the response given by the server (successful, error, etc.) and other parameters relating to the operating system and the user’s IT environment.

- RIGHTS OF THE INTERESTED PARTY (GDPR articles 15-22)
At any time, the interested party may exercise the right to:
- ask for confirmation of the existence or otherwise of your personal data.
- obtain information about the purposes of the processing, the categories of personal data, the recipients or categories of recipients to whom the personal data have been or will be communicated and, when possible, the retention period.
- obtain the rectification and deletion of data.
- obtain the limitation of the processing.
- obtain data portability, i.e. receive them from a data controller, in a structured format, commonly used and readable by an automatic device, and transmit them to another data controller without hindrance.
- oppose the processing at any time and also in the case of processing for direct marketing purposes.
- oppose an automated decision-making process relating to natural persons, including profiling.
- to lodge a complaint with the Italian Data Protection Authority.
